When applying for a home loan balance transfer, you will typically need to provide a set of documents to facilitate the process.
1. Loan Application Form: Complete and duly sign an application form for the home loan balance transfer.
2. Know Your Customer (KYC) Documents:
3. Income Proof:
4. Property Documents:
5. Loan Statements: Copies of the loan statements from the existing lender showing the outstanding balance.
6. No Objection Certificate (NOC): NOC from the existing lender stating that they have no objection to the balance transfer.
7. List of Documents with the Existing Lender: A list of original property documents held by the existing lender.
8. Credit Report: A copy of your credit report, which the new lender may obtain to assess your creditworthiness.
9. Employment Proof: For salaried individuals, a letter from the employer confirming employment and salary details.
10. Property Valuation Report: Some lenders may request a current valuation report of the property.
